Output 255d89434b16a7306da7594ab2a199d391984eaae539f8370382469a199eef91:1

value
3057276
script pubkey
OP_0 OP_PUSHBYTES_20 10cba351a35750c64107b835a091812a75541013
address
ltc1qzr96x5dr2agvvsg8hq66pyvp9f64gyqnyv6qu8
transaction
255d89434b16a7306da7594ab2a199d391984eaae539f8370382469a199eef91
spent
true